  CE250
 
 
  KVM Console Extender, PS/2  
  The ATEN new PS/2 KVM Console Extender allows access to a computer system or a KVM switch from a remote console (keyboard, monitor, and mouse), from up to 500 feet away, via a CAT5e cable. This unit is perfect for moving the console away from the computer or the KVM switch. Your console can be moved across the room or hall, out of the server room, or anywhere that is most convenient. It is also useful for security and monitoring purposes, where you can have the system unit in a secure area at the same time that you put the console in the most convenient location for user access and monitoring. A PS/2 KVM Console Extender is a cost effective solution because it uses inexpensive UTP (CAT5e) cabling to extend the distance, versus expensive and bulky coaxial cabling. It is easy to install and operate because of the Auto Signal Compensation (ASC) technology, which senses the distance and adjusts the signal levels accordingly so there is no need to do any dip switch setting.  
     
  Features:  
 
Built-in ASIC for greater reliability and compatibility
Category 5e UTP Ethernet cable to connect the local and remote units
Dual console operation - control your system from both the local and remote PS/2 keyboard, mouse, and monitor consoles
Push button selection of the active console
High resolution video - up to 1024 x 768 @ 150 m (max.)
Supports VGA, SVGA, and Multisync monitors
Local monitor supports DDC; DDC2; DDC2B
Automatic gain control
 
 
  Requirements:  
 
Consoles:
The console must consist of the following components:
VGA, SVGA, or Multisync monitor
PS/2 keyboard
Either an HDB-15 video port, or for the legacy Sun, a Sun 13W3 video port;
PS/2 mouse
Computers:
The following components must be installed on each computer that is to be connected to the KVM Console Extender:
With PS/2 Type Connectors:
VGA, SVGA or Multisync card.
6-pin PS/2 (mini-DIN) mouse port.
6-pin PS/2 (mini-DIN) keyboard port.
With AT Type Connectors:
VGA, SVGA or Multisync card.
DB-9 (standard serial) mouse port plus mouse adapter*
5-pin DIN (standard AT) keyboard port plus keyboard adapter*
* Adapters not included, but can be purchased separately.
